CUA is a really fun school in a great area. The university provides tremendous opportunites through location and through the help of the faculty and offered courses. While the name may be a little scary for some people, CUA is as Catholic as you make it. There are opportunites to become involved religiously however catholicism is not in any way forced upon you. CUA is an excellen school because it is a small school in a big city, so you can meet plenty of people and always find fun things to do, yet still have the comfort of a smaller environment, where you are not just a number in a lecture hall but an individual student.
